Mal's POV
She was leaving. The words echoed in his mind, like the ringing of a bell long after the bell had stopped. He stood there, slack jawed, his feet firmly planted to the metal beneath them. He wanted to follow, to go after her, to beg her to stay, but he just couldn't will himself to move. It felt like a piece of his soul had been ripped out, leaving a black hole where she had been.
Slowly, he made his way back to the lonely bunk he occupied. Along the way, he had stopped at the door to her shuttle. He even had gone so far as raising his fist to knock upon the door, but he couldn't go through with it. And entering as he used to, without her permission, just felt wrong somehow.
